We present measurements of branching fractions in the b -> s s-bar s penguin-dominated decays B+ --> phi K+ and B0 --> phi K0 in a sample of approximately 89 million BBbar pairs collected by the BaBar detector at the PEP-II asymmetric-energy B-meson factory at SLAC. We determine B(B+ --> phi K+) = (10.0 +0.9 -0.8 +/- 0.5) x 10^{-6} and B(B0 --> phi K0) = (8.4 +1.5 -1.3 +/- 0.5) x 10^{-6}. Additionally, we measure the CP-violating charge asymmetry ACP (B+/- --> phi K+/-) = 0.04 +/- 0.09 +/- 0.01, with a 90% confidence interval of [-0.10, 0.18], and set an upper limit B(B+ --> phi pi+) < 0.41 x 10^{-6} (at the 90% confidence level).
